Professor
Today, we're discussing the ethics of targeted advertising. Some people argue that online advertising which uses personal information to target specific people is an invasion of privacy. Others argue that it's simply an acceptable way to reach consumers with products and services they' re interested in. What' s your take? Do you think targeted advertising is ethical, or is it an invasion of privacy?
Jessica
I think targeted advertising is an invasion of privacy. Advertisers shouldn't be able to track and use our personal information to sell us products. It' s not fair to consumers,and it' s a violation of our rights. Instead,advertisers should focus on creating high-quality ads that appeal to a broad audience.
Mike
I disagree with Jessica. I think targeted advertising is ethical.It' s a more efficient way to reach consumers with products and services that are relevant to their interests. Plus, consumers can always opt-out of targeted advertising by adjusting their privacy settings. As long as advertisers give users a choice, I think targeted advertising can be beneficial for both businesses and consumers.

Section Title: 6 Article Revision
I wholeheartedly agree with Mike's perspective that targeted advertising is ethical, as it allows consumers to choose their preferred advertisements. Furthermore, I believe that targeted advertising can save people's time and reduce a company's expenses. With the increasing complexity of online content, people spend a significant amount of time sifting through information; hence, accurate delivery is essential for time efficiency. For instance, if I am searching for a bag and evaluating different options, irrelevant advertisements for beauty products or music would hinder my data collection process.
Moreover, advertising entails substantial financial investments; however, imprecise ad placements may result in high costs and insufficient returns. For example, if a sports company selling footballs utilizes widespread advertising, they may reach individuals such as artists, teachers, and singers who have no interest in purchasing their product. This ineffective approach wastes resources and does not yield the desired outcomes. Therefore, targeted advertising not only saves consumers' time but also reduces companies' expenditures by ensuring ads reach the appropriate audience. (170 words)

How Academic Discussion Is Scored
The TOEFL Academic Discussion task is evaluated based on the official ETS scoring rubric. AI evaluation analyzes each response across multiple dimensions.
Relevance & Contribution
Does the response address the question and contribute meaningfully to the discussion?
Language Use
Grammar accuracy, vocabulary range, and sentence structure quality.
Development & Support
Are ideas well-developed with specific examples and clear reasoning?
Common Patterns Across Responses
Based on analysis of user submissions for this task, here are common patterns observed in student responses.
Many students provide clear opinions but lack specific supporting examples.
Strong responses directly reference the reading passage and other speakers' viewpoints.
Higher-scoring responses use varied sentence structures and academic vocabulary.
Time management is a key factor — responses that feel rushed tend to score lower on development.
Learning Tips
Read the prompt carefully and identify all parts of the question before writing.
Reference the reading passage and the other students' opinions in your response.
Use specific examples to support your main point — avoid generic statements.
Aim for 120-150 words. Longer responses are not always better; clarity and focus matter more.
Practice timed responses (10 minutes) to build fluency under exam conditions.
